Health Care & Dependent<br />
Health Care<br />
Reimbursement Account<br />
• Reimbursement provided for<br />
medical, dental, vision and<br />
other health care expenses not<br />
reimbursed by any health care<br />
plan<br />
• Maximum before-tax<br />
contribution: $5,000/year<br />
• Minimum before-tax<br />
contribution: $240/year<br />
Care Accounts<br />
Dependent Care<br />
Reimbursement Account<br />
• Reimbursement provided for<br />
dependent care expenses that<br />
enable you (and your spouse,<br />
if married) to work<br />
• Maximum before-tax<br />
contribution: $5,000/year;<br />
$2,500/year if you are<br />
married and file separate<br />
returns 1<br />
1 Highly compensated employees (salary <strong>of</strong> $110,000 or greater) are limited to<br />
a lower Dependent Care Reimbursement Account maximum
